Why Sleep and Stress Supplements Are in High Demand
According to the American Sleep Association, 70 million Americans suffer from sleep disorders. Meanwhile, surveys from the American Psychological Association consistently find that stress levels among adults are high and increasing each year. What does this mean for supplement brands? A golden opportunity.
Consumers are actively seeking nutraceuticals rather than pharmaceutical sleep aids and anti-anxiety medications, and many are finding comfort in melatonin, magnesium, L-theanine, valerian root, and even newer options like ashwagandha and passionflower.
Better sleep doesn’t just improve mood—it’s linked to stronger immune function, improved cognition, better digestion, and even heart health. That means supplement brands don’t need to limit their messaging to sleep alone. They can promote total body wellness that starts with a good night’s rest.

Ingredients to Watch (and Formulate With)
To manufacture a best-selling sleep or stress relief supplement, it’s all about choosing the right ingredients—science-backed, safe, and on-trend. Here are a few standout players:
1. Melatonin
Still the king of the sleep supplement world, melatonin helps regulate the sleep-wake cycle. Makers Nutrition can manufacture melatonin in gummies, capsules, powders, and more.
2. L-Theanine
This amino acid, naturally found in green tea, promotes relaxation without drowsiness. It's perfect for stress relief formulas that consumers can take during the day or before winding down at night.
3. Magnesium Glycinate
Gentle on the stomach and highly bioavailable, magnesium glycinate is a favorite for calming the nervous system and reducing tension.
4. Ashwagandha
This adaptogenic herb has gained major traction in recent years for its ability to reduce cortisol levels and promote a sense of calm. We can help you offer both standard and high-potency versions.
5. Lemon Balm & Chamomile
Both botanicals are well-known for their calming properties and are perfect for inclusion in gummies and capsule blends.
6. GABA (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id)
GABA is a neurotransmitter that helps soothe the nervous system and is often used in formulas designed to ease anxiety and promote better sleep quality.
7. Reishi Mushroom
An adaptogen that supports immune health and relaxation, reishi is a great ingredient for dual-function formulas focused on both stress and vitality.
